Output c41f650070b891dd24e57edbf596c64133ce24d0cf422da3ce141baf3cfcf825:0

value
52751804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866ccd0e111ab4bba58d26fa1cc45d522ef05e98 OP_EQUAL
address
3DwnosgvcvhoAwtTTpwmVXFJwVtmXyNMYW
transaction
c41f650070b891dd24e57edbf596c64133ce24d0cf422da3ce141baf3cfcf825
confirmations
316954
spent
true